Description

Practice sight word fluency with your kindergarteners, first and second graders using this engaging, fun, fast paced snowball fight! Help students sharpen this crucial reading skill while having a bit of fun no matter how you are learning. It is also completely EDITABLE to help fit the needs of your diverse learners!

This game has instructions that work for both in person and distance learning.

Students will practice the following leveled sight words from the Jan Richardson Guide to Guided Guided:

  • Level A Sight Words
  • Level B Sight Words
  • Level C Sight Words
  • Level D Sight Words
  • Level E Sight Words
  • Level F Sight Words
  • Level G Sight Words
  • Level H-J Sight Words

All activities are in a Google Slides format. You will need a Google Account in order to properly use the materials.

The text is editable so you can change up the questions to fit your needs.
